lists.openwall.net   lists  /  announce  owl-users  owl-dev  john-users  john-dev  passwdqc-users  yescrypt  popa3d-users  /  oss-security  kernel-hardening  musl  sabotage  tlsify  passwords  /  crypt-dev  xvendor  /  Bugtraq  Full-Disclosure  linux-kernel  linux-netdev  linux-ext4  linux-hardening  linux-cve-announce  PHC 
Open Source and information security mailing list archives
 
Hash Suite: Windows password security audit tool. GUI, reports in PDF.
[<prev] [next>] [<thread-prev] [thread-next>] [day] [month] [year] [list]
Date:	Wed, 27 Oct 2010 17:53:52 +0530
From:	Jaswinder Singh <jaswinderlinux@...il.com>
To:	Takashi Iwai <tiwai@...e.de>
Cc:	Jaroslav Kysela <perex@...ex.cz>,
	Linux Kernel Mailing List <linux-kernel@...r.kernel.org>
Subject: Re: ALSA sound/pci/hda/hda_intel.c:2624: no codecs found

On Wed, Oct 27, 2010 at 1:14 PM, Takashi Iwai <tiwai@...e.de> wrote:
> At Wed, 27 Oct 2010 12:57:35 +0530,
> Jaswinder Singh wrote:
>>
>>
>> [    7.854510] IOAPIC[0]: Set routing entry (8-22 -> 0xa9 -> IRQ 22
>> Mode:1 Active:1)
>> [    7.854515] HDA Intel 0000:00:1b.0: PCI INT A -> GSI 22 (level,
>> low) -> IRQ 22
>> [    7.854569] HDA Intel 0000:00:1b.0: irq 47 for MSI/MSI-X
>> [    7.854589] HDA Intel 0000:00:1b.0: setting latency timer to 64
>> [    7.854593] ALSA sound/pci/hda/hda_intel.c:2529: chipset global
>> capabilities = 0x4401
>> [    7.859681] ALSA sound/pci/hda/hda_intel.c:913: codec_mask = 0x0
>> [    7.859687] ALSA sound/pci/hda/hda_intel.c:2624: no codecs found!
>
> So, the hardware (BIOS) tells no codec is connected to this bus.
>

Hmm, very strange, but In BIOS sound is enable. How is this possible.

> As a last resort, you can try to load with probe_mask=0x10f.  This
> will probe the codec chips forcibly no matter whether it's present or
> not.
>

# /sbin/insmod sound/pci/hda/snd-hda-intel.ko probe_mask=0x10f

[  536.851846] HDA Intel 0000:00:1b.0: PCI INT A -> GSI 22 (level,
low) -> IRQ 22
[  536.851849] hda_intel: codec_mask forced to 0xf
[  536.851908] HDA Intel 0000:00:1b.0: irq 47 for MSI/MSI-X
[  536.851927] HDA Intel 0000:00:1b.0: setting latency timer to 64
[  536.851932] ALSA sound/pci/hda/hda_intel.c:2529: chipset global
capabilities = 0x4401
[  537.857929] ALSA sound/pci/hda/hda_intel.c:706: azx_get_response
timeout, polling the codec once: last cmd=0x000f0000
[  538.856516] ALSA sound/pci/hda/hda_intel.c:706: azx_get_response
timeout, polling the codec once: last cmd=0x000f0000
[  539.855096] ALSA sound/pci/hda/hda_intel.c:716: azx_get_response
timeout, switching to polling mode: last cmd=0x000f0000
[  540.853681] ALSA sound/pci/hda/hda_intel.c:724: No response from
codec, disabling MSI: last cmd=0x000f0000
[  541.852269] ALSA sound/pci/hda/hda_intel.c:1429: Codec #0 probe
error; disabling it...
[  542.858837] ALSA sound/pci/hda/hda_intel.c:1429: Codec #1 probe
error; disabling it...
[  543.865396] ALSA sound/pci/hda/hda_intel.c:1429: Codec #2 probe
error; disabling it...
[  544.871963] ALSA sound/pci/hda/hda_intel.c:1429: Codec #3 probe
error; disabling it...
[  544.879942] ALSA sound/pci/hda/hda_intel.c:913: codec_mask = 0x0
[  544.879949] ALSA sound/pci/hda/hda_intel.c:1456: no codecs initialized
[  544.880011] HDA Intel 0000:00:1b.0: PCI INT A disabled
[  544.880037] HDA Intel 0000:02:00.1: PCI INT B -> GSI 17 (level,
low) -> IRQ 17
[  544.880039] hda_intel: codec_mask forced to 0xf
[  544.880086] HDA Intel 0000:02:00.1: irq 47 for MSI/MSI-X
[  544.880102] HDA Intel 0000:02:00.1: setting latency timer to 64
[  544.880105] ALSA sound/pci/hda/hda_intel.c:2529: chipset global
capabilities = 0x1001
[  544.883989] ALSA sound/pci/hda/hda_intel.c:1351: codec #0 probed OK
[  545.882519] ALSA sound/pci/hda/hda_intel.c:706: azx_get_response
timeout, polling the codec once: last cmd=0x100f0000
[  546.881107] ALSA sound/pci/hda/hda_intel.c:706: azx_get_response
timeout, polling the codec once: last cmd=0x100f0000
[  547.879688] ALSA sound/pci/hda/hda_intel.c:716: azx_get_response
timeout, switching to polling mode: last cmd=0x100f0000
[  548.878273] ALSA sound/pci/hda/hda_intel.c:724: No response from
codec, disabling MSI: last cmd=0x100f0000
[  549.876863] ALSA sound/pci/hda/hda_intel.c:1429: Codec #1 probe
error; disabling it...
[  550.879431] ALSA sound/pci/hda/hda_intel.c:1429: Codec #2 probe
error; disabling it...
[  551.882009] ALSA sound/pci/hda/hda_intel.c:1429: Codec #3 probe
error; disabling it...
[  551.908789] ALSA sound/pci/hda/hda_intel.c:1675: azx_pcm_prepare:
bufsize=0x4b00, format=0x11
[  551.908800] ALSA sound/pci/hda/hda_codec.c:1227:
hda_codec_setup_stream: NID=0x2, stream=0x1, channel=0, format=0x11
[  551.908847] ALSA sound/pci/hda/hda_intel.c:1675: azx_pcm_prepare:
bufsize=0x4b00, format=0x11
[  551.908855] ALSA sound/pci/hda/hda_codec.c:1227:
hda_codec_setup_stream: NID=0x2, stream=0x1, channel=0, format=0x11
[  551.910077] ALSA sound/pci/hda/hda_codec.c:1290:
hda_codec_cleanup_stream: NID=0x2
[  551.910111] ALSA sound/pci/hda/hda_codec.c:1290:
hda_codec_cleanup_stream: NID=0x2
[  551.912482] ALSA sound/pci/hda/hda_intel.c:1675: azx_pcm_prepare:
bufsize=0x10000, format=0x11
[  551.912492] ALSA sound/pci/hda/hda_codec.c:1227:
hda_codec_setup_stream: NID=0x2, stream=0x1, channel=0, format=0x11
[  551.912515] ALSA sound/pci/hda/hda_intel.c:1675: azx_pcm_prepare:
bufsize=0x10000, format=0x11
[  551.912524] ALSA sound/pci/hda/hda_codec.c:1227:
hda_codec_setup_stream: NID=0x2, stream=0x1, channel=0, format=0x11
[  551.945208] hda-intel: IRQ timing workaround is activated for card
#0. Suggest a bigger bdl_pos_adj.


Thanks,
--
Jaswinder Singh.
--
To unsubscribe from this list: send the line "unsubscribe linux-kernel" in
the body of a message to majordomo@...r.kernel.org
More majordomo info at  http://vger.kernel.org/majordomo-info.html
Please read the FAQ at  http://www.tux.org/lkml/

Powered by blists - more mailing lists

Powered by Openwall GNU/*/Linux Powered by OpenVZ